reference, declaration → definition definition → references, declarations, derived classes, virtual overrides reference to multiple definitions → definitions unreferenced |
1399 MachineBasicBlock *BB = I.getParent(); 1400 MachineOperand &ImmOp = I.getOperand(1); 1410 Register DstReg = I.getOperand(0).getReg(); 1413 const RegisterBank *RB = MRI->getRegBankOrNull(I.getOperand(0).getReg()); 1428 I.setDesc(TII.get(Opcode)); 1429 I.addImplicitDefUseOperands(*MF); 1430 return constrainSelectedInstRegOperands(I, TII, TRI, RBI); 1433 const DebugLoc &DL = I.getDebugLoc(); 1435 APInt Imm(Size, I.getOperand(1).getImm()); 1439 ResInst = BuildMI(*BB, &I, DL, TII.get(AMDGPU::S_MOV_B64), DstReg) 1440 .addImm(I.getOperand(1).getImm()); 1447 BuildMI(*BB, &I, DL, TII.get(Opcode), LoReg) 1450 BuildMI(*BB, &I, DL, TII.get(Opcode), HiReg) 1453 ResInst = BuildMI(*BB, &I, DL, TII.get(AMDGPU::REG_SEQUENCE), DstReg) 1462 I.eraseFromParent();